“R.E.S.P.E.C.T.: The Legends of Soul” Pre-Concert Chat

11 April 2012 2 Comments

CJO Artistic Director Byron Stripling sits down with California soul singer Chris Pierce for a preview of “R.E.S.P.E.C.T.: The Legends of Soul,” April 11-15 at the Southern Theatre.

Show Description:

Beg, scream and shout as the CJO pays homage to the legendary figures of soul!

There will be dancing in the streets to the sounds of Atlantic, Stax and Motown and the legendary figures of soul including “The Godfather of Soul” James Brown, Sam Cooke, “Mr. Excitement” Jackie Wilson, Otis Redding, Ike & Tina, and “The Queen of Soul” Aretha Franklin.
